qXR-PTX-PE is an AI-powered software that assists radiologists by automatically analyzing adult chest X-rays to detect signs of pleural effusion and pneumothorax. It helps prioritize cases by providing case-level outputs within the existing PACS/workstation without altering images or providing direct clinical diagnosis, thereby improving workflow efficiency.

Annalise Enterprise CTB Triage-OH is an AI-powered software tool designed to help clinicians prioritize brain CT scans by detecting features suggestive of obstructive hydrocephalus. It integrates with hospital imaging and order management systems to flag and prioritize suspicious cases, enabling faster review and improving clinical workflow without replacing clinical decision-making.

Brainomix 360 Triage ICH is a software tool that uses artificial intelligence to analyze non-contrast brain CT images in acute settings to detect suspected intracranial hemorrhages. It notifies specialists promptly to prioritize patient care and improve workflow efficiency by providing timely alerts via mobile and web applications. It supports clinicians by assisting triage but does not replace diagnostic evaluation.

UltraSight AI Guidance is a mobile AI-based application that helps non-expert medical professionals acquire high-quality cardiac ultrasound images by providing real-time guidance on how to position and manipulate the ultrasound probe for standard transthoracic echocardiography views. It enhances image acquisition quality and enables better diagnosis even by novice users.

Annalise Enterprise CTB Triage Trauma is an AI-powered software that assists clinicians by automatically analyzing brain CT scans to identify signs of acute hemorrhages. It helps prioritize studies in the workflow to ensure patients with urgent findings are reviewed faster, improving triage and clinical efficiency. The system integrates with existing imaging management systems and does not provide standalone diagnostic decisions but supports clinicians in managing their workload.

Annalise Enterprise CXR Triage Trauma is an AI-based software tool designed to assist clinicians by analyzing adult chest X-ray images to detect features suggestive of vertebral compression fractures. It integrates with hospital image and order management systems to prioritize cases with potential fractures, facilitating timely review in clinical workflows such as Bone Health and Fracture Liaison Service programs. The device supports clinicians in identifying urgent cases but does not replace clinical decision-making.

Annalise Enterprise CXR Triage Trauma is an artificial intelligence-based software that assists clinicians by automatically analyzing adult chest X-rays to identify signs of pleural effusion and pneumoperitoneum. It integrates with hospital imaging systems to prioritize urgent cases in the clinical workflow, helping healthcare providers quickly identify critical findings and streamline patient care.

Viz AAA is an AI-powered software device designed to analyze CT angiogram images of the abdomen to detect suspected abdominal aortic aneurysms. It helps specialists prioritize patient studies by flagging those with potential aneurysms, improving workflow efficiency in clinical settings. The software provides non-diagnostic preview images and emphasizes that diagnostic decisions remain with treating specialists.

Rapid NCCT Stroke is software that uses artificial intelligence to analyze non-contrast head CT scans and quickly notify clinicians about suspected areas of brain hemorrhage or large vessel blockage. This helps prioritize urgent cases and speeds up patient care, but it is intended to assist—not replace—clinical judgment and diagnosis.

Oncospace is a software tool that assists radiation oncologists and medical dosimetrists in planning radiotherapy treatments for patients with cancer in the prostate, head, and neck regions. It uses locked machine learning algorithms to predict achievable dose objectives for organs at risk based on the patient's anatomy and automates aspects of treatment plan optimization. This helps clinicians customize treatment protocols, optimize radiation dose delivery while sparing healthy tissue, and review treatment plans efficiently, ultimately supporting better patient care in radiation oncology.
